The English Inn

Occasionally, when you may least expect it, you come across a spot in the world where time seems to have stood still, where graciousness of spirit and personal attention to detail still thrive, where the hustle and bustle of the modern world are shut and the lingering taste of a good Burgundy on your palate is all that matters. The English Inn is just such a place.

Outdoor Dinner During A Pandemic

Reviewed By JPintheD

We celebrated two birthdays at The English Inn in one of their “igloos”. Ours was actually a small greenhouse that worked really well. There were 2 space heaters and we were comfortable even with it being 18 degrees out. Our food server was able to talk to us through the door to maintain social distancing and she wore her mask every time she came in to deliver food or pick-up plates. We had the ribeye, filet and salmon and the food was delicious. The Inn is very quaint and has 6 bedrooms in the main building and 11 cottages that look like they would be very enjoyable during the warmer months. There was a $10 per person fee to secure our reservation.
